Récupérer des chaines de caractères

Résolu
cs_gaspard83 Messages postés 20 Date d'inscription jeudi 14 août 2003 Statut Membre Dernière intervention 28 janvier 2006 - 29 nov. 2005 à 19:12
malalam Messages postés 10839 Date d'inscription lundi 24 février 2003 Statut Membre Dernière intervention 2 mars 2010 - 30 nov. 2005 à 10:57
Bonjour à tous,



Je voulais savoir si il existait un script php qui permet de récupérer
les chaines de caractères (le texte des pages html et plus précisément
des flux RSS) pour ensuite les récupérer dans une variable ?

Merci à tous pour votre aide

3 réponses

malalam Messages postés 10839 Date d'inscription lundi 24 février 2003 Statut Membre Dernière intervention 2 mars 2010 25
30 nov. 2005 à 10:57
Le RSS est une application du xml, voilà tout. C'est du XML pur et simple. Il utilise simplement une DTD, une structure bien définie et normalisée (enfin, une par version de RSS...).
SimpleXML si tu es en php5.
Sinon, DOMXML.
Regarde la doc à une de ces entrées, tu verras, ce n'est pas très très compliqué.
Il y a aussi des tas de parseurs xml sur ce site... ;-) (des généralistes, et des spécialisés rss).
3
malalam Messages postés 10839 Date d'inscription lundi 24 février 2003 Statut Membre Dernière intervention 2 mars 2010 25
30 nov. 2005 à 08:50
Hello,

il existe des tonnes de parseurs RSS sur le net, en php.
Google est ton ami, comme qui dirait... ;-)
A vrai dire, il y en a même sur ce site, dans les codes, j'en ai vu.
0
cs_gaspard83 Messages postés 20 Date d'inscription jeudi 14 août 2003 Statut Membre Dernière intervention 28 janvier 2006
30 nov. 2005 à 09:34
Merci malalam pour ta réponse. Je croyais que le RSS était un XML lui-même parsé, c'est pour ça que je demandais comment récupérer le texte brut sans les mises en forme du RSS, de telle sorte à obtenir des chaines de caractères utilisables et propres pour les injecter comme variables...
Qu'en dis-tu ?
0
Rejoignez-nous